Before any troubleshooting, prioritize personal safety. A stopped vibrating screen may still hold electrical charge or have mechanically tensioned springs. Follow these actions in order.
Turn off the main power supply to the screen and apply a lockout/tagout device to prevent accidental restart. Verify with a voltage tester that no current remains. Only then approach the equipment.

Was it a sudden stop with a loud bang? A gradual slowdown? Did the motor trip the circuit breaker? Each scenario points to different root causes. Record any alarms or error codes from the control panel before resetting.
Once safety checks are complete, diagnose the likely cause using the following hierarchy.
If the motor does not hum at all, check the starter, fuses, and thermal overload relays. A single-phase condition (one blown fuse) often causes the motor to hum but not rotate. In such cases:
Important: Never restart the motor more than three times in quick succession; this can overheat and destroy the windings.
